Key Rights Under the Package Travel Regulations
Before You Travel
- You will receive all essential information about the package before the contract is concluded.
- There is always at least one trader who is liable for the proper performance of all the travel services included in the contract.
- You are given an emergency telephone number or details of a contact point where you can get in touch with the organiser or the travel agent.
- You may transfer the package to another person, on reasonable notice and possibly subject to additional costs.
- The price of the package may only be increased if specific costs rise (for instance, fuel prices) and if expressly provided for in the contract, and in any event not later than 20 days before the start of the package. If the price increase exceeds 8% of the price of the package, you may terminate the contract.
- You may terminate the contract without paying any termination fee and get a full refund of any payments if any of the essential elements of the package, other than the price, has changed significantly. If before the start of the package the trader responsible for the package cancels the package, you are entitled to a refund and compensation where appropriate.
- You may terminate the contract without paying any termination fee before the start of the package in the event of exceptional circumstances, for instance if there are serious security problems at the destination which are likely to affect the package.
During Your Holiday
- If any of the travel services are not performed in accordance with the contract, the organiser must remedy the lack of conformity, unless this is impossible or entails disproportionate costs.
- If a significant proportion of the travel services cannot be provided as agreed, suitable alternative arrangements will be offered to you at no extra cost.
- You may be entitled to a price reduction and/or compensation for damages where travel services are not performed or are improperly performed.
- The organiser must provide assistance if you are in difficulty, including in circumstances of insolvency.
Insolvency Protection
- If the organiser or retailer becomes insolvent, your payments will be refunded.
- If the organiser becomes insolvent after the start of the package and if transport is included in the package, your repatriation is secured.

Definition of a Package
A "package" under the PTR is a combination of at least two different types of travel services (for example, transport and accommodation, or accommodation and other tourist services like guided tours or car hire) for the purpose of the same trip, where:
- Those services are combined by one trader, or
- Those services are purchased from separate traders through linked online booking processes
